Technical Superiority in Action
Let's break down what makes this industrial-grade inverter special:
| Feature | Specification | Industry Average |
|---|---|---|
| Maximum Efficiency | 98.7% | 97.2% |
| Start-up Voltage | 150V | 180V |
| MPPT Channels | Dual tracking | Single channel |

FAQ: 50kW Inverters Demystified
Q: Can it handle three-phase motor loads? A: Yes, designed for 380-480VAC three-phase systems with soft-start capability.
Q: What's the warranty period? A: Standard 5-year warranty, extendable to 10 years with maintenance contracts.
Q: Grid-tie functionality available? A: Certified for connection to national grids in 18 countries including US, Germany and Australia.
